#LekkiMassacre: “He Can Find It But Can’t Find Stable Power Supply” – Nigerians Attack Fashola Over Mystery Camera Discovery

Nigeria minister of works and housing, Babatunde Raji, has come under unrelenting scathing remarks and sarcastic comments following his discovery of a mystery camera at the Lekki toll-gate.

Lekki toll-gate is the protest ground of the EndSARS demonstrators who converged at the spot for two weeks demanding an end to police brutality and also agitating for police reform.

But what started as a peaceful protest spiralled into a well thought out carnage after men of the Nigerian army opened fire on the protesters last week, killing at least nine persons.

The incident sparked widespread outrage both ocally and internationally with former united states secretary of state, Hilary Clinton, and the democrats presidential candidate for the 2020 US election, Joe Biden, condemning the use of brute and excessive force on the unarmed protesters.

Subsequently, the toll-gate was razed and looted in the chain of mind-numbing havoc wreaked by hoodlums who went on rampage in the aftermath of the shooting.

In the preceding days following the shooting and destruction, the toll-gate was visited by many people including Lagos state governor, Babajide Sanwo-Olu, a couple of cleaners who volunteered to clean up the place and Arise TV crew, who made live coverage of the scene and also accessed the level of damage done to toll-gate. Many individuals and security operatives were also at the scene.

None of the aforementioned people spotted a camera at the scene.

But in a bizarre twist of event, the former Lagos state governor, while touring the toll-gate yesterday alongside other south west governors, discovered the hitherto elusive camera.

“I think this will help with the ongoing investigations into the shootings at the  Lekki Toll Gate.

“It requires forensic analysis and could be used in the investigations to unravel the mystery surrounding the shootings at the Toll Gate, I believe.” He said.

Nigerians have, however, expressed their misgivings with the minister’s discovery, with many saying it’s part of the government’s plan to convolute investigations into the Lekki Massacre.

In a remark couched in a derisive garb, one Twitter user, identified simply as Tosin, said “Fashola can find a camera from nowhere but can’t find stable power supply. Naija our country 🤡😂”
